namespace juce
{
//==============================================================================
class UIARangeValueProvider  : public UIAProviderBase,
                               public ComBaseClassHelper<IRangeValueProvider>
{
public:
    explicit UIARangeValueProvider (AccessibilityNativeHandle* nativeHandle)
        : UIAProviderBase (nativeHandle)
    {
    }
    //==============================================================================
    JUCE_COMRESULT SetValue (double val) override
    {
        if (! isElementValid())
            return (HRESULT) UIA_E_ELEMENTNOTAVAILABLE;
        const auto& handler = getHandler();
        if (auto* valueInterface = handler.getValueInterface())
        {
            auto range = valueInterface->getRange();
            if (range.isValid())
            {
                if (val < range.getMinimumValue() || val > range.getMaximumValue())
                    return E_INVALIDARG;
                if (! valueInterface->isReadOnly())
                {
                    valueInterface->setValue (val);
                    VARIANT newValue;
                    VariantHelpers::setDouble (valueInterface->getCurrentValue(), &newValue);
                    sendAccessibilityPropertyChangedEvent (handler, UIA_RangeValueValuePropertyId, newValue);
                    return S_OK;
                }
            }
        }
        return (HRESULT) UIA_E_NOTSUPPORTED;
    }
    JUCE_COMRESULT get_Value (double* pRetVal) override
    {
        return withValueInterface (pRetVal, [] (const AccessibilityValueInterface& valueInterface)
        {
            return valueInterface.getCurrentValue();
        });
    }
    JUCE_COMRESULT get_IsReadOnly (BOOL* pRetVal) override
    {
        return withValueInterface (pRetVal, [] (const AccessibilityValueInterface& valueInterface)
        {
            return valueInterface.isReadOnly();
        });
    }
    JUCE_COMRESULT get_Maximum (double* pRetVal) override
    {
        return withValueInterface (pRetVal, [] (const AccessibilityValueInterface& valueInterface)
        {
            return valueInterface.getRange().getMaximumValue();
        });
    }
    JUCE_COMRESULT get_Minimum (double* pRetVal) override
    {
        return withValueInterface (pRetVal, [] (const AccessibilityValueInterface& valueInterface)
        {
            return valueInterface.getRange().getMinimumValue();
        });
    }
    JUCE_COMRESULT get_LargeChange (double* pRetVal) override
    {
        return get_SmallChange (pRetVal);
    }
    JUCE_COMRESULT get_SmallChange (double* pRetVal) override
    {
        return withValueInterface (pRetVal, [] (const AccessibilityValueInterface& valueInterface)
        {
            return valueInterface.getRange().getInterval();
        });
    }
private:
    template <typename Value, typename Callback>
    JUCE_COMRESULT withValueInterface (Value* pRetVal, Callback&& callback) const
    {
        return withCheckedComArgs (pRetVal, *this, [&]() -> HRESULT
        {
            if (auto* valueInterface = getHandler().getValueInterface())
            {
                if (valueInterface->getRange().isValid())
                {
                    *pRetVal = callback (*valueInterface);
                    return S_OK;
                }
            }
            return (HRESULT) UIA_E_NOTSUPPORTED;
        });
    }
    //==============================================================================
    JUCE_DECLARE_NON_COPYABLE_WITH_LEAK_DETECTOR (UIARangeValueProvider)
};
} // namespace juce
